Frustrating weekend for Kirkham at Donington
[Image: halsallracinglogo.jpg]

It was a frustrating weekend at Donington Park for the Halsall Biker Gear Kawasaki team with Jon Kirkham missing out on a top ten finish for the first time since joining the team at Knockhill.

Despite putting in front-running times in the first two sectors of the 2.48 mile Leicestershire circuit, Kirkham struggled in the final sector across the weekend.

Things started to look up for the team in Saturday’s qualifying with Kirkham running solid times in Q3. In the second session, the Derby rider set a time good enough for tenth position with three minutes to go but was unfortunately knocked back to 13th in the closing moments unable to better his team having used the best of his Pirelli tyre.

Kirkham continued to show pace through the first two sectors in Sunday’s first race but losing up to 0.7 seconds in the final split meant he was unable to progress through the back. Suffering brake issues in the closing stages, he crossed the line 12th.

Having qualified higher up the grid for the second outing, Kirkham made good progress off the line to join the battle for sixth place. However, with the race one braking issues resurfacing the 29-year-old slipped back through the pack to eventually finish 13th.

Jon Kirkham:

“I’m disappointed with today’s results, I really wanted to impress with it being my home round and bring some good results home for the team. We struggled with the final sector all weekend and that was really highlighted in race one. We changed the bike quite dramatically for the second race but it didn’t seem to be the right direction and the brake issues in both races didn’t help either. The top sixteen riders were so close this weekend you couldn’t afford to give a couple of tenths away like we did. We’ve made such great progress every round this season, this is the first time we haven’t gone better which is a shame as Donington is usually a good track for me. Hopefully it’s just a one off bad weekend and that we’ll be back towards the top six at Assen.”

Jack Valentine, Team Manager:

“It’s been a frustrating weekend, we’ve really struggled through the final sector. Jon’s been as quick as anyone else through the first two sectors all weekend but the last sector we’ve been losing up to 0.7 seconds. We made quite a few changes to try and make it better and still couldn’t improve it. Things weren’t helped with a brake issue in the first race. We made a major change for the second race and it was a bit better. I thought he’d be able to hang on to the back of the battle for sixth but then the brake issue surfaced again, so that’s something we’re going to have to investigate as it really hampered his progress. It’s not been a great weekend but you get weekends like this, we’ve made a lot of progress recently and hopefully we can get back on that path at Assen.”

Kirkham and the Halsall Biker Gear Kawasaki team are back in action for Round 10 of the MCE Insurance British Superbike Championship at TT Circuit Assen between 19-21 September.
